Foundation Stabilizing in Seminole County, FL

Foundation stabilizing services are designed to address issues related to uneven or shifting foundations that can affect the stability of a property. These services typically involve techniques such as underpinning, mudjacking, or piering to reinforce the existing foundation and prevent further movement. Projects commonly include homes experiencing settlement, cracks in walls or floors, or signs of uneven flooring. Property owners often seek this service to protect their investment, improve safety, and maintain the structural integrity of their home or building.

Common Foundation Stabilizing Jobs

Foundation stabilization involves techniques to strengthen and support compromised foundation structures.

Pier and beam repair addresses settling or shifting in homes built on piers or beams.

Mudjacking and leveling correct uneven concrete slabs caused by soil movement.

Crack repair seals fo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.

Drainage solutions improve water flow away from the foundation to reduce soil erosion.

Soil stabilization involves methods to reinforce the ground beneath the foundation for added stability.

Foundation Stabilizing Questions

What is foundation stabilizing? Foundation stabilizing involves techniques to reinforce and support a building’s foundation, helping to prevent or repair settling and shifting issues.

When is foundation stabilization needed? Stabilization may be necessary if there are signs of u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, or doors and windows that don’t close properly.

What methods are used for foundation stabilization? Common methods include underpinning, piering, and mudjacking, which help restore stability to the foundation.

Will foundation stabilization fix all foundation problems? While it can address many types of foundation issues, the effectiveness depends on the specific condition and extent of the damage.
